ORA-42300: an Editioning view is already defined on this table ORACLE 报错 故障修复 远程处理
ORA-42300: an Editioning view is already defined on this table
Cause: An attempt was made to create an Editioning view on a table on which another Editioning view is already defined in the same Edition. This violates a restriction that at most one Editioning view may be associated with any base table in a given Edition.
Action: Create the new view as a regular view or, if the view being created is really intended to be an Editioning view associated with this table, drop the existing Editioning view before creating the new one.
ORA-42300: an Editioning view is already defined on this table 是Oracle数据库中的一个常见错误,它表明执行版本视图操作时发生了冲突。这也是由ORA-42300错误代码指示的。由于该错误,你不能创建版本视图,因为它可能已经存在。
解决此错误的方法很简单,但是需要仔细检查代码,使你能够确定是否已经存在在表时定义的版本视图。如果检查发现存在,那么就可以使用DROP VIEW语句删除该版本视图,然后重新创建
否则请检查定义的版本视图,并仔细检查SQL语句以及表或索引,以确保正确定义版本视图。也要检查定义版本视图的用户有没有足够的权限,没有可以使用GRANT语句来授予。最后,当你执行版本视图操作时 一定要先不使用OR REPLACE VIEW语句,而改用CREATE VIEW语句。
此外,有必要检查表中是否存在Triggers,以避免执行避免潜在和版本视图冲突的操作。此外,还可以使用DROP TABLE语句来删除版本视图,然后重新创建。删除表后,要确保引用表和索引等对象的定义已经正确的重新定义。
最后,要确保使用一个可靠的SQL操作表达式来定义版本视图,以确保可以实现必要的结果集。通过检查代码,检查用户的权限,删除和重新创建版本视图,以及使用正确的SQL操作,你应该能够解决ORA-42300: an Editioning view is already defined on this table这个错误。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 ORA-42300: an Editioning view is already defined on this table ORACLE 报错 故障修复 远程处理
相关文章
- ORA-22894: cannot add constraint on existing unscoped REF columns of non-empty tables ORACLE 报错 故障修复 远程处理
- ORA-23629: string.string is not an eligible index on table string.string for comparison ORACLE 报错 故障修复 远程处理
- ORA-28650: Primary index on an IOT cannot be rebuilt ORACLE 报错 故障修复 远程处理
- ORA-28673: Merge operation not allowed on an index-organized table ORACLE 报错 故障修复 远程处理
- ORA-32167: No payload set on the Message ORACLE 报错 故障修复 远程处理
- ORA-47411: Cannot use string due to Oracle Database Vault policy. ORACLE 报错 故障修复 远程处理
- ORA-54013: INSERT operation disallowed on virtual columns ORACLE 报错 故障修复 远程处理
- ORA-10614: Operation not allowed on this segment ORACLE 报错 故障修复 远程处理
- ORA-12024: materialized view log on “string”.”string” does not have primary key columns ORACLE 报错 故障修复 远程处理
- ORA-12051: ON COMMIT attribute is incompatible with other options ORACLE 报错 故障修复 远程处理
- ORA-16806: supplemental logging is not turned on ORACLE 报错 故障修复 远程处理
- ORA-19038: Invalid opertions on query context ORACLE 报错 故障修复 远程处理
- Oracle数据库文件如何迁移?完美解决方案!(oracle文件迁移)
- Oracle 最佳实践指南(oracle最好的书)
- 尚观国际进军云计算市场:与Oracle合作推出最新技术(尚观国际oracle)
- Oracle中如何正确传递日期参数(oracle日期参数)
- Oracle 数据库中添加语句的实战方法(oracle 中添加语句)
- 研究Oracle数据库的模糊搜索表(oracle中模糊搜索表)
- Oracle数据库中文显示优化实践(oracle中文显示)
- 的作用Oracle 数据库管理PGA的作用(oracle 中pga)
- 利用Oracle中的If In语句减少数据处理时间(oracle中if in)
- Oracle如何为表添加新属性(oracle为表添加属性)
- Oracle MA未来数据库技术趋势分析(oracle ma)